Police investigating an ‘attempted abduction’ in Letchworth on Sunday have concluded the incident didn’t take place.
It was reported to the police that at around 2pm, a 10-year-old girl was approached by a man in B&M Home Store in Second Avenue, he led her out of the shop and carried her before putting her back down near Aldi.
Police launched an investigation to find the man, however a police spokeswoman has now said: "Following further investigations into the alleged abduction of a 10-year-old girl in Letchworth on Sunday, August 11, officers are now satisfied that the incident did not in fact take place. No further action is being taken at this time."
